Why is animal print so popular when it comes to fashion? Leopard print is definitaly the most trending pattern of the moment, but snake skin and cheetah print are close behind.
Leopard print came into fashion around the 1950’s and was seen on designer bags and on cat walks. At this same time the first leopard print bathing suit was worn down the cat walk.
Some say that the leopard look is trashy and over done, some others say it is an iconic and classic look that can be worn forever. It is shown to be classy when seen on red carpets or at top notch events.
Some celebrities that have worn leopard print or do wear leopard print include Kate Moss who has always been in touch with the print and wore a leopard coat to her 30th birthday party and Paris fashion week in September of 2019.
Rihanna wore a statement-making leopard piece to her friend’s birthday party. This article claimed she showed excitement about the revival of leopard. She has also been seen wearing a long leopard dress to her own Visual Autobiography Launch in October of 2024. Harry Styles wore a leopard piece to Burberry’s Spring 2014 runway event.
Leopard print did fall out but definitely came back very hard around the 2000’s. It is said that this print represents luxury, confidence, and power.
